    Battery Replacement

    Modern electronic key fobs offer greater convenience and function as compared to manual keys, but they'll continue to be unable to charge or stop working over time. If the VW key fob is not responding to button presses, or if the lock and unlock buttons are taking longer than usual to respond, the battery may need to be replaced.

    To accomplish this task, you'll need to use an CR2032 battery as well as a small screwdriver. Open the key by pressing the metal button. look for the battery panel of the mobile key volkswagen, which is typically situated just below the Volkswagen logo on the fob. Push upwards to remove the panel and then press the button on your key fob to re-insert the battery. Make sure the positive side of the battery is facing down.

    Key Fob Replacement

    Modern VWs come with key fobs that aren't just keys, but advanced anti-theft devices. When you press the button on your VW keyfob the microchip sends out an encoded code that informs your car that it's the right key to unlock and start. The key fobs also include the chip used to operate features like remote lock and push-button start.

    If your Volkswagen keyfob has stopped working properly, you may have to replace the battery. If this is the case it is usually evident by the frequency at which you need to press the lock/unlock buttons. If you find yourself pressing the lock/unlock button frequently then it is most likely that the battery has to be replaced.

    The buttons on your volkswagen car key replacement keyfob may have become stuck or loose. This is typical because keys are jostled to a great extent. It can be fixed by gently prying the fob apart and manually altering the buttons.
